Katima to spend N$30 million on upgrading three roads
The Katima Mulilo Town Council has budgeted N$30 million to upgrade and refurbish three of the town’s roads in the next financial year. The identified streets, – a combined 3.1km long – are the Dr Hage Geingob, Richard Muhinda, and Soweto roads. Chief executive Raphael Liswaniso revealed this during the council’s N$190-million budget presentation on Thursday.
